
8-bit multiplying digital-to-analog converter (DAC) featuring an 11.8MS/s conversion rate and 85ns settling time. This unipolar output device offers a differential output and a universal digital logic interface with parallel input. Operating with dual supply voltages from 4.5V to 18V, it boasts a full-scale error of 1LSB. The component is housed in an N package with tin-lead contact plating, suitable for operation across a wide temperature range of -55°C to 125°C.
